//------------------------------------------------
//--- 010 Editor v12.0.1 Binary Template
//
// File: dt_wwise_event.bt
// Authors: Lucas Schwiderski
// Version:
// Purpose:
// Category: Darktide
// File Mask: *.wwise_event
// ID Bytes:
// History:
//------------------------------------------------
/***********************************************************************
File Definition:
***********************************************************************/
uint32 version <format=hex>;
Assert(version == 0x1b);
uint32 length;
// A section of values that don't belong the actual Wwise bank
struct {
uint32 unknown1;
Assert(unknown1 == 0x0);
// Matches the file itself
uint64 this_file <format=hex>;
uint32 unknown2;
Assert(unknown2 == 0x40);
uint32 unknown3;
Assert(unknown3 == 0x0);
// The following hash-like values will probably define some of these values:
// - name of the event
// - Wwise bus the event runs on
// Corresponds to the `id` value of a HIRC object of type "event" later on in the file
uint32 hirc_event_id <format=hex>;
// No particularly clear value.
// Sometimes when interpreted as `float`, it produces whole numbers.
// Sometimes, it's very close to `0xFFFFFFFF`.
uint32 unknown4;
// Following two usually look like hashes.
// Also often reasonably looking floats close to `1`. Could be something like volume.
// Would still fit with it sometimes showing up elsewhere in a `.wwise_bank`: It's not unreasonable
// for the bnk to have volume values as well.
// In at least one instance, shows up in `MotionBus`/`MotionFX` sections in a `.wwise_bank`.
uint32 unknown5 <format=hex, comment="Looks like a short hash">;
// At least in one instance, this was identical with `unknown6`
uint32 unknown6 <format=hex, comment="Looks like a short hash">;
uint32 unknown7;
Assert(unknown7 == 0x0 || unknown7 == 0x1);
uint32 unknown8;
Assert(unknown8 == 0x0 || unknown8 == 0x1);
uint32 unknown9;
Assert(unknown9 == 0x0);
uint32 unknown10;
Assert(unknown10 == 0x0);
} header;
struct bnk
{
#include "bnk.bt";
} wwise_bank <open=true>;
